U Store Mini Storage-South Lyon

271 Lottie Street, South Lyon
Website: http://www.ustoremi.com
Phone: (248) 437-1600

Categories: Health & Medical Services  Oil & Petroleum Products  Storage And Warehousing  Transportation Facilities & Services 

Suggest updates

Reviews

Sorry, we haven't any reviews about company U Store Mini Storage-South Lyon.

Write a review

The nearest companies